kehren

German

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/ˈkeːʁən/
  • (file)
  • Rhymes: -eːʀən

Etymology 1

From Old High German kerian, kerien, from Proto-Germanic *karzijaną, from Proto-Indo-European *gers- (to bend, turn). See char.

Verb

kehren (third-person singular simple present kehrt, past tense kehrte, past participle gekehrt, auxiliary haben)

  1. to sweep

Etymology 2

From Old High German kēran.

Verb

kehren (third-person singular simple present kehrt, past tense kehrte, past participle gekehrt, auxiliary haben)

  1. (archaic, still in Switzerland) to turn (change the direction of movement)
